/* * Test cases where there's a reference to a module * * var myMod = angular.module('myMod', []); * myMod.controller( ... ) * */ var assert = require('should'), annotate = require('./util').annotate, stringifyFnBody = require('./util').stringifyFnBody; describe('annotate', function () { it('should annotate declarations on referenced modules', function () { var annotated = annotate(function () { var myMod = angular.module('myMod', []); myMod.controller('MyCtrl', function ($scope) {}); }); annotated.should.equal(stringifyFnBody(function () { var myMod = angular.module('myMod', []); myMod.controller('MyCtrl', [ '$scope', function ($scope) { } ]); })); }); it('should annotate declarations on referenced modules when reference is declared then initialized', function () { var annotated = annotate(function () { var myMod; myMod = angular.module('myMod', []); myMod.controller('MyCtrl', function ($scope) {}); }); annotated.should.equal(stringifyFnBody(function () { var myMod; myMod = angular.module('myMod', []); myMod.controller('MyCtrl', [ '$scope', function ($scope) { } ]); })); }); it('should annotate object-defined providers on referenced modules', function () { var annotated = annotate(function () { var myMod; myMod = angular.module('myMod', []); myMod.provider('MyService', { $get: function(service) {} }); }); annotated.should.equal(stringifyFnBody(function () { var myMod; myMod = angular.module('myMod', []); myMod.provider('MyService', { $get: ['service', function(service) {}] }); })); }); // TODO: it should annotate silly assignment chains it('should not annotate declarations on non-module objects', function () { var fn = function () { var myOtherMod = { controller: function () {} }; var myMod, myOtherMod; myMod = angular.module('myMod', []); myOtherMod.controller('MyCtrl', function ($scope) {}); }; var annotated = annotate(fn); annotated.should.equal(stringifyFnBody(fn)); }); });
